I want to change my exhaust system for the following:

Scoobysport 3" downpipe, HKS Hiper centre and Backbox.Reading through the deluge of information on the BBS this seems a good setup for my tastes!

Does anyone know if I can get the whole lot fitted at one place or will I have to get them done separately? (I live about 10 miles in towards London from Maidstone).

Also, If I was to carry this out in 2 stages how will the new parts fit to my current standard system. ie. Can you fit a 3" Scoobysport downpipe as the only addition to a standard system? Or alternatively can I fit the HKS Hiper centre to a standard downpipe?

Firstly which MY car do you have MY'00 or MY'01 or other?

If its pre MY'01, you can fit the SS and the HKS together or at different times to the stock stuff if you can't afford both at the same time...
